In this episode of World Class, Dr. J. Jayakiran Sebastian joins us to reflect on his article “Nicene Faith – Towards a Contemporary Reformed Reading.” Together, we revisit the Council of Nicaea—1700 years ago—and explore why it still matters for the church today.
From empire and power shaping theology in the 4th century to the ongoing struggles of churches in Asia with identity, denominationalism, colonial legacies, economic disparity, and the quest for unity, Dr. Sebastian helps us see how reaching back to Nicaea can provide wisdom for moving forward.
What does it mean to live out Nicene faith in contexts marked by marginalization and pluralism? How can the church reclaim an ecumenical vision of unity while remaining faithful to Christ? Join us for a conversation that connects history, theology, and the realities of the global church today.
